Abstract
The invention discloses a sweet potato vine harvesting machine which comprises a rack, wherein a vine harvesting mechanism and a vine assembling mechanism are arranged on the rack; the vine harvesting mechanism consists of an arc-shaped seedling lifting-up lever fixed on the rack, and a reciprocating cutter positioned below the seedling lifting-up lever; and the vine assembling mechanism consists of a vine conveying runner positioned above the rear end part of the seedling lifting-up lever and driven by a power mechanism to rotate, a plurality of strip-shaped tooth hooks are arranged on the vine conveying runner, and the vine assembling mechanism further comprises a plurality of vine separating teeth positioned on a baffle plate behind the rack. The sweet potato vine harvesting machine can adapt to different ridge shapes (all terrains), the damage to stems of sweet potatoes can be decreased, sweet potato vines can also be harvested, and the sweet potato vine harvesting machine can provide an economic and effective mode for treatment of sweet potato vines.
